Devayani entered the Tamil film industry during the mid-1990s, a period dominated by hyper-masculine action films and conventional romantic dramas. However, she carved out a distinct niche by portraying characters that balanced traditional values with emotional resilience.

Devayani Rajakumaran is a legendary figure in Tamil entertainment, having transitioned from a 1990s "silver screen queen" to a "mega-serial" powerhouse. Her career is defined by her graceful screen presence and her ability to portray emotionally resilient characters in both films and long-running television dramas.
The evolution of Tamil television and cinema over the last three decades cannot be fully documented without examining the profound impact of Devayani Rajakumaran. As an actor, producer, and cultural icon, Devayani has shaped the landscape of Tamil entertainment content and popular media. Her transition from a leading cinematic heroine in the 1990s to the undisputed queen of Tamil television soap operas in the 2000s represents a unique case study in media adaptation and audience loyalty. Unlike many of her contemporaries who faded from public memory, Devayani has shown remarkable adaptability. In the late 2010s, she embraced reality television as a judge on Mr. & Mrs. Chinnathirai , where she shed her “crying heroine” image to reveal a witty, sharp, and fashion-forward persona. In the late 90s and early 2000s, she delivered over 50 films, with a high percentage of them being blockbusters.
During this era, popular media and film journalism frequently contrasted Devayani with her contemporaries. While other actresses were marketed for their glamour, Devayani’s media image was built on dignity, traditional aesthetics, and emotional relatability. This specific framing secured her a massive, loyal fan base among female audiences—a demographic that would later prove crucial to her career longevity.
